Output 15c89f404c51b5c580deb8d207cf8f9e17d6e26644783a495f2d588d03cd2afa:1

value
630400
script pubkey
OP_0 OP_PUSHBYTES_20 f1d378bb7d1c633d1d9f86ff25aee4e4dfe5cbaf
address
bc1q78fh3wmar33n68vlsmljtthyun07tja0kvsk59
transaction
15c89f404c51b5c580deb8d207cf8f9e17d6e26644783a495f2d588d03cd2afa
spent
true